University College Merit Scholarships for Transfer Students



Merit Awards for Transfer Students with a 3.0 or higher GPA.

Saint Joseph's University College is proud to introduce our new scholarship guidelines for 2008-2009 academic year. Under these guidelines, students will no longer be required to file the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A). However, students who plan to apply for federal or state financial aid are encouraged to do so by May 1 of each academic year for which they are enrolled.

Saint Joseph's University College for Continuing Studies offers the University College Merit Scholarships. These scholarships are designed for continuing studies transfer students who have demonstrated scholastic achievement. To be considered for this award, the student must be admitted to University College as a full or part-time undergraduate, typically must have a minimum of 60 transferable credits or an associate's degree, minimum 3.0 GPA, be seeking his or her first bachelor's degree, be attending Saint Joseph's University for the first time and meet the specific scholarship program criteria. Non-U.S. citizens are not eligible for these awards.

  University College Merit Scholarship   Phi Theta Kappa Scholarship  
 

UC Merit Scholarships are awarded based on a student's cumulative (in-coming) transfer grade point average (from all institutions attended combined) at the time of application and the number of credits the student enrolls. After the first semester, the scholarship is automatically renewed provided the student maintains a minimum GPA of B+. In order for the scholarship to be applied, students must register for the semester. If a student chooses to reduce credits enrolled, then scholarship funds will be adjusted to reflect the appropriate range. Scholarships are awarded for the fall and spring semester.

Members of the Phi Theta Kappa National Honor Society are encouraged to apply for a varying number of renewable, up to $5,000 per year, scholarships. A minimum 3.3 GPA, an AA, AD, or AAS degree or 60 transferable credits are required. Non U.S. citizens and students with bachelor degrees are not eligible.

Please note that University College reserves the right to modify the University College Merit and Phi Theta Kappa Scholarships at any time.

  Full-Time Enrolled Students (12-15 credits per semester)  
  Transfer GPA 3.0-3.49 $2500 per academic year/$1250 per semester  
  Transfer GPA 3.5-3.69 $3500 per academic year/$1750 per semester  
  Transfer GPA 3.7-4.0 $5000 per academic year/$2500 per semester  
       
  Three-Quarter Time Enrolled (9 credits per semester)  
  Transfer GPA 3.0-3.49 $1875 per academic year/$937.50 per semester  
  Transfer GPA 3.5-3.69 $2625 per academic year/$1312.50 per semester  
  Transfer GPA 3.7-4.0 $3750 per academic year/$1875 per semester  
       
  Half-Time Enrolled (6 credits per semester)*Minimum to be considered  
  Transfer GPA 3.0-3.49 $1250 per academic year/$625 per semester  
  Transfer GPA 3.5-3.69 $1750 per academic year/$875 per semester  
  Transfer GPA 3.7-4.0 $2500 per academic year/$1250 per semester  

Scholarships are awarded on a rolling basis, however, priority will be given to students who have applied before the following priority deadlines.

  • For fall applicants, July 1st is the priority deadline for University College Merit Scholarship consideration.
  • For spring applicants, November 1st is the priority deadline for University College Merit Scholarship consideration.  

Applications postmarked after the appropriate priority deadline will be given scholarship consideration based on availability of funds.  Please note that if you plan to compl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A), you are strongly encouraged to do so before May 1st to determine if you are eligible for a state grant.

To be considered for these University College Merit Scholarships, the completed application for admission, including all required official transcripts, and the UC Merit Scholarship Application or the PTK Scholarship Application are required.
